The Quiet Lessons in Every Click: Growth Happens Between the Pieces

Beneath the fun lies a foundation of development. As small fingers grasp, twist, and snap blocks into place, fine motor skills sharpen. Recognizing how shapes fit in three-dimensional space nurtures spatial intelligence. When a bridge collapses for the third time, problem-solving kicks in—not through frustration, but persistence. We’ve seen it: the moment a child realizes alignment matters, their eyes widen with quiet triumph. These aren’t milestones marked on a chart—they’re victories whispered in concentration, celebrated with a high-five. And when parents offer gentle guidance instead of taking over, they teach something even more valuable: confidence.
